What graphene coating actually involves, step by step
Foam pre-wash and wheel cleaning. The vehicle gets a foam pre-wash and a separate wheel-and-tire cleaning pass first, using different wash mitts for paint and wheels, since brake dust and road grime carried from the wheels onto the paint surface is a common source of fine scratching in the steps that follow.
Chemical decontamination. An iron remover strips embedded brake-dust particles out of the clear coat, and a tar or bug remover lifts road tar and insect residue, both applied before any mechanical contact with the paint, since these contaminants sit below what a wash mitt alone can reach.
Clay bar treatment. A clay bar or clay mitt is worked across every panel with a lubricant to pull out the remaining bonded contaminants — overspray, industrial fallout — leaving the paint surface physically smooth to the touch, which is the actual test that decontamination is complete.
Paint inspection and correction. The paint is inspected under raking light for swirl marks and light scratches, and a correction polish is run where needed, because a coating applied over existing swirl marks locks that texture in permanently instead of hiding it.
Panel wipe-down. Every panel gets a final wipe with isopropyl alcohol solution immediately before coating, removing any polish or wax residue left behind, since coating bonds to bare clear coat and any oily residue left on the surface is what causes an uneven, patchy cure.
Coating application and cure. The coating is applied panel by panel in a controlled, dust-free space at a specific humidity and temperature range, then left undisturbed for the cure period the product calls for before the vehicle is exposed to rain or a wash.
What goes wrong when graphene coating is done badly
Coating over unfinished swirl marks. Skipping paint correction and applying coating directly over existing swirl marks and light scratches does not hide that texture — it seals it in permanently under a hard layer, since ceramic coating is a clear, thin film that follows the surface underneath rather than filling it in.
Bonding failure from residual oils. Any wax, sealant, or polish oil left on the panel from a previous product, or from the correction step itself, prevents the coating from bonding evenly to the clear coat, which shows up later as high spots, streaking, or patches that wear through faster than the rest of the panel.
Curing in the wrong conditions. Applying coating outside the temperature and humidity range the product is rated for can cause it to flash-cure too fast, leaving visible high spots and streaks in the finish that have to be polished back out and reapplied rather than settling on their own.
Water exposure before the cure period ends. Getting the vehicle wet — rain, a wash, even heavy dew — before the coating has fully cured leaves water-spot marks in the surface, since the coating hasn't finished hardening enough yet to resist mineral deposits from standing water.

How to choose who does the work in West University Place
Does the quote include paint correction before the coating is applied, or coating only? Coating applied over unaddressed swirl marks locks those imperfections in rather than fixing them. Is the full prep chain — wash, decontamination, clay bar, iron remover, panel wipe — specified, or just 'prep' as one line? Skipping steps like iron removal or clay bar leaves contaminants under the coating, which shortens how well it holds up. What coating tier is being quoted — SiO2 vs. graphene, single-layer vs. multi-layer — and what protection length does that tier typically carry in the market? Tiers vary widely in durability and price, so it helps to know exactly which one is being quoted. Is a written explanation of proper post-coating maintenance — wash method, curing window, products to avoid — provided? Incorrect washing during the curing period can compromise how well a coating bonds. Does the quote distinguish exterior paint coating from wheel, interior, or window coating packages? These are often priced and sold as separate add-ons even when marketed together. Is it explained clearly that coating does not stop rock chips or deep scratches? Coatings add hardness against light swirling but not impact protection, and that distinction is where overselling most often happens.
A quote listing 'coating' as a single line item with no breakdown of the prep steps. Prep quality — decontamination, clay bar, iron removal — affects how well a coating bonds, and a bid that skips describing it may be skipping the steps too. A tier described only by price, with no protection length or product type specified. Tiers vary widely in durability, and a price with no spec behind it is hard to compare to another bid. A price dramatically lower than every other quote for the same vehicle and tier. An unusually low price can mean a thinner coating, skipped decontamination steps, or a shorter-lasting product sold as a premium one. No explanation of post-coating maintenance or the curing window. Washing a freshly coated vehicle too soon, or with the wrong products, can compromise how the coating bonds. Any claim that the coating will stop rock chips, dents, or deep scratches. Coatings add surface hardness against light swirling, not impact protection, and a shop that blurs that distinction is overselling what the product does.
How Graphene Differs From Standard Ceramic
A standard ceramic coating is silica-based (SiO2); a graphene coating blends graphene oxide into that same base chemistry. Graphene conducts heat far better than silica alone, which changes how the coating sheds heat and interacts with water on the surface.
